THCA could be the acidic type and natural precursor to THC. THCA does not make euphoria in its organic condition. Nonetheless, when warmth is applied, THCA undergoes a chemical response by means of a method known as decarboxylation. This natural system converts THCA into euphoric THC.

In advance of it really is transformed, it has an additional carboxylic acid team. The structure is what stops it from providing psychoactive effects. After the team is taken off, it is converted into THC and normally takes on intoxicating effects.
